After flying high against Hampton Roads Academy last Tuesday, Norfolk Academy came back down to earth. The Bulldogs came up short against the Kellam Knights on Wednesday, falling 12-4. The Bulldogs were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Knights ap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in April of 2017.
Norfolk Academy's loss dropped their record down to 10-9. As for Kellam, their win was their fourth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 6-4.
Looking ahead, Norfolk Academy will venture away from home to challenge Norfolk Christian at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day. As for Kellam, they will host Kempsville at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
